%X Different from the traditional method of estimating seismic attenuation based on the waveform of single event,we regarded a series of events as an equivalent one,and obtained seismic attenuation on the basis of cross-correlation function between source and signal recorded at distance.We performed a field experiment by the end of 2004,and based on the data of this experiment,we studied the amplitude degression and corresponding seismic attenuation factor of both single event waveform and cross-correlation function.It is found that,same as single event waveform,cross-correlation function could be used to assess the seismic attenuation.The results show:(1) Q of in-situ medium is about 40;(2) Amplitude degressions with distance of single event waveform and cross-correlation functions are much similar.
